Correcting for nonlinear measurement errors in the dependent variable in the general linear model
Authors:John P Buonaccorsi  Tor D Tosteson
Institution:1. Department of Mathematics and Statistics , University of Massachusetts Amherst , MA, 01003;2. Department of Community and Family Medicine Dartmouth Medical School , Biostatistics and Epidemiology Group , Hanover, NH, 03755-3861
Abstract:Linear models are considered in which measurement error is present in the dependent variable. Observed values are related to true values via nonlinear regression models with the parameters in the measurement error models being estimated with the use of independent, external data, collected using standards. Pseudo-maximum likelihood estimators and their asymptotic properties are developed under normality assumptions and the common approach of simply analyzing imputed values obtained from the nestimated calibration curves is assessed. A small simulation evaluates the procedures. An example is presented in which urinary neopterin (measured via radioimmunoassay) is nbeing compared between two groups of individuals.
Keywords:calibration  errors-in-variables  EM algorithm  nonlinear regression  pseudo-maximum likelihood  radioimmunoassay
